WebCH 4–2.2 Life Cycle Sustainment Overview Life cycle sustainment planning is a key function of the defense acquisition system for the development of military capabilities. The goal of life cycle sustainment planning is to maximize readiness by delivering the best possible product support outcomes at the lowest O&S Cost. While weapon system ... WebReference Source: DODI 5000.85 3D.2.b.(6) Corrosion Prevention and Control (CPC). As part of the corrosion prevention and mitigation planning required by Section 2228 of Title 10, U.S.C., incorporate DoDI 5000.67-required CPC maintenance processes to mitigate the impact of corrosion on materiel readiness and sustainment costs.
